Portugal vs Spain: Nations League final has date and time set

The stage is set for a thrilling Iberian showdown as Portugal and Spain battle for UEFA Nations League glory this Sunday, June 8. The highly anticipated final kicks off at 8 PM (UK time) at the iconic Allianz Arena in Munich, Germany.
A Historic Duel: Who Will Win Their Second Nations League Title?
This final isn’t just about regional bragging rights. It will crown the first team to win the UEFA Nations League twice. Portugal claimed the inaugural title in 2018/19, while Spain are the reigning champions after their triumph in 2022/23. France, who won the 2020/21 edition, have already been knocked out.
How Portugal and Spain Reached the Final
Portugal sealed their place in the final with a dramatic comeback win over host nation Germany in the semi-finals on June 4. After falling behind to an early goal from Florian Wirtz, the Portuguese fought back with goals from Francisco Conceição and Cristiano Ronaldo, clinching a 2-1 victory at the Allianz Arena.
Spain, on the other hand, delivered a five-star performance to defeat France 5-4 in a thrilling encounter at Stuttgart’s Mercedes-Benz Arena. Goals came from Mikel Merino, Pedri, Lamine Yamal (twice), and Nico Williams, as La Roja outgunned a French side that scored through Rayan Cherki, Kylian Mbappé, a Dani Vivian own goal, and Randal Kolo Muani.

Germany vs France: Third-Place Playoff
Before the final, football fans can enjoy another blockbuster as Germany face France in the third-place match. That clash is scheduled for 10 AM on the same day at the Mercedes-Benz Arena in Stuttgart.
